如何优化富士康CAD二次开发应用程序加载的方法?
本文主要讨论如何优化富士康CAD二次开发应用程序加载的方法。富士康CAD二次开发应用程序是一种基于富士康CAD平台进行二次开发的应用程序,用于满足用户特定的需求。然而,在加载过程中可能会出现较长的加载时间和卡顿现象,影响用户体验。因此,本文将重点分析并介绍一些优化方法,以加快富士康CAD二次开发应用程序的加载速度。
代码优化是提高富士康CAD二次开发应用程序加载速度的关键。在二次开发应用程序中,首先需要对代码进行优化,以消除冗余代码和无效操作。可以通过以下几种方式实现代码优化:
使用缓存机制是提高富士康CAD二次开发应用程序加载速度的有效方法。可以将已加载过的资源,如图片、样式表和脚本文件等,缓存在本地,下次加载时直接从缓存读取,避免重复下载。另外,还可以使用浏览器缓存,将静态资源设置为长时间有效,减少服务器请求次数。
压缩文件对于提高富士康CAD二次开发应用程序加载速度也非常有效。可以对代码、样式表和图片等文件进行压缩,减少文件大小,从而减少网络传输的数据量。常见的压缩方法包括使用Gzip或Deflate算法对文件进行压缩,以及使用图片压缩工具对图片文件进行优化。
将一些非关键性的资源和模块设置为异步加载,可以显著提高富士康CAD二次开发应用程序的加载速度。异步加载可以使页面呈现更快,同时不影响关键资源的加载。可以使用JavaScript的动态加载机制,如使用defer或async属性加载脚本、使用动态创建DOM节点等。
预加载策略是另一种优化富士康CAD二次开发应用程序加载速度的方法。可以在页面加载的同时,提前加载下一步操作所需要的资源,以减少用户等待时间。可以使用预加载属性或JavaScript代码预加载资源,如预加载图片、预加载脚本等。
懒加载技术是一种延迟加载非关键资源的方法,可以进一步提高富士康CAD二次开发应用程序的加载速度。当页面滚动时,再加载可视区域内的资源,以减少一次性加载大量资源的时间。可以使用JavaScript库或自定义代码实现懒加载功能。
综上所述,通过代码优化、缓存机制、压缩文件、异步加载、预加载策略和懒加载技术等方法,可以有效地提高富士康CAD二次开发应用程序的加载速度。在实际应用中,可以根据具体情况选择适合的优化方法,以达到更好的用户体验。
BIM技术是未来的趋势,学习、了解掌握更多BIM前言技术是大势所趋,欢迎更多BIMer加入BIM中文网大家庭(http://www.wanbim.com),一起共同探讨学习BIM技术,了解BIM应用!
相关培训